Cleaning uPVC windows

Cleaning upvc windows repairs (click for info) can be simple, but it is crucial to be sure that you employ the right tools and materials. In this way, you can prevent the accumulation of dust and moisture that could damage your uPVC windows.

First clean your uPVC windows. This can be done using a brush or a soft clean cloth that's been submerged in the warm, soapy water.

After you have removed all debris, it is now time to clean the frame. When cleaning uPVC, you'll need to be recommended to stay clear of chemicals, liquids, or aggressive cleaners. They can cause irreparable harm. Instead, you should use a non-abrasive cleaning solution which is diluted with water.

You can also clean your uPVC window sills. This requires professional assistance. In addition, it is important to avoid using sandpaper on your uPVC. Use a soft-nozzle brush.

It is recommended to spray paint uPVC if it has been stained. These spray paints come in a range of colors and offer an excellent finish. They are a great option in the event that you want to renew your uPVC windows.

You are also able to find a reliable uPVC solvent cleaner at your local hardware shop. The safest uPVC cleaners are ones that are dilute with water. Be sure not to accidentally smear the glass with the cleaner.

After you are done, dry the window using a non-abrasive , non-abrasive sponge. After that, you can polish the glass with a microfiber cloth.

It is recommended that you get your uPVC window frames cleaned at least twice a calendar year in order to keep them in good working order. Additionally to that, if they're situated near trees, you may need to have them cleaned more frequently.

Maintaining your uPVC windows and doors in good condition will help to increase the value of your home. It can help reduce the need to undertake costly repairs by making sure they are clean and well maintained. Your home can be protected from moisture and mould by keeping your uPVC windows clean.

Longevity of upvc windows repair windows

The life span of uPVC windows can be up to 35 years depending on the quality of the product. But the average lifespan is between 20 and 25 years. Regular maintenance can prolong the life expectancy of UPVC windows.

The quality of the raw materials used in windows is often one of the major aspects that determine the longevity of UPVC windows. Poor quality raw materials could decrease the life span of a uPVC window to as short as 5 years. To prevent this, examine the pigmentation of the product. The lack of pigmentation can be an indication that the product isn't made up of enough UV-resistant ingredients.

Other factors that may affect the life span of a uPVC product include a lack of proper installation. A poorly installed upvc window repairs product might not be watertight and also be exposed to corrosion.
